ACCOUNT MANAGER

Eastern Canada | Outside Sales

About the company and the role

Composite Power Group has operated as an electrical utility sales representative for over 45 years. Our sales team takes the initiative to connect the suppliers in our portfolio with companies building the grid. We focus on the sale of equipment for high-voltage distribution lines, transmission lines, and substations, and we work with industry-leading suppliers committed to innovation and doing business in Canada.

We are a growing company with a national presence and manage a large sales portfolio. We offer our team independence and autonomy in decision-making to develop long-term, trust-based partnerships with our customers and suppliers.

We are looking for a highly motivated Account Manager to join our team in Quebec, with a preference for the Greater Montreal Area. The role is ideal for individuals who can blend sales and business development skills with knowledge of power systems. Top performers in our business build and grow strong customer relationships by facilitating and consulting with customers on the specification and sale of high-voltage electrical equipment. Top performers can also execute long-cycle sales plans that require connecting with and influencing key decision-makers across our customers’ organizations, including senior managers, procurement teams, engineers, and field operations staff.

Details of the position

Type :   Permanent, Full Time

Compensation range : 110,000 CAD – 160,000+ CAD

Compensation comprises a base salary, vehicle benefits, and a sales incentive that increases with sales results. The base salary will be determined by the candidate’s education, experience, and relationships.

Location :   Montreal (Preferred), Candidates located elsewhere in Quebec or one of the Atlantic provinces will also be considered

The successful candidate will work from a home office three days a week and at the Longueuil office two days a week.  This is not a fully remote position .

Travel :   Must be willing to travel frequently throughout Quebec, New Brunswick, Nova Scotia, Prince Edward Island, and Newfoundland and Labrador, and occasionally to other parts of Canada and the US.

Key Responsibilities :

  • Develop and maintain strong, trusting, and loyal working relationships with customers, suppliers, and team members.
  • Consult with customers on capital spending plans and procurement plans to help focus business development and sales activities.
  • Be comfortable interacting effectively with clients of all levels and backgrounds, from executives to front-line construction workers. The ability to connect and communicate with engineers and project managers is critical to this role.
  • Be self-motivated and autonomous, able to plan and organize sales calls and own schedule to make efficient use of resources.
  • Have the ability to create and deliver high-calibre technical and commercial presentations.
  • Understand market pricing, competition, and the competitive environment. Strive to sell on value vs. price.
  • Develop, present, and effectively close proposals and RFQs ranging from large projects and multi-year contracts to quotes for parts and components.
  • Resolve technical and commercial issues with support from vendors and other team members.
  • Track and manage sales activity in a CRM environment (Salesforce.com).

Qualifications :

  • A university degree or a college diploma in Electrical Engineering is preferred. Education can take many forms - we are open to speaking with candidates who believe they have the skills and capabilities for this position through equivalent industry experience.
  • Minimum 5 years of experience working in the Quebec utility industry or other relevant industry experience that provides insight and understanding of our customer base.
  • Knowledge of power distribution, transmission, and substation construction is considered an asset.
  • Ability to read and understand engineering drawings, bills of materials, specifications, and industry standards.
  • Existing customer or client relationships in the electric utilities, engineering firms, and / or contractors in Alberta are considered assets.
  • Familiarity with Microsoft 365.
  • Excellent communication skills in English and in French.
